The reference axis of the lamp must be parallel to the longitudinal axis of the vehicle (i.e. The 15° line
marked on the bracket top should be perpendicular to the direction of travel).
The centre line of the lamp module must be parallel to the ground.
The arrow engraved on lens surface must always be pointing away from longitudinal axis of the vehicle.
Lamp must be visible from 20° inboard and outboard, as well as from 10° above and below the horizontal
axis.
Lamps must be mounted no less than 250 mm and no more than 1500 mm above the ground.
Lamps should not be mounted closer than 600 mm together (400 mm if vehicle width is less than 1300 mm).
Notes: Please refer to ECE Regulation No. 48 for more details.

Mounting Instructions
Drill three Ø3 mm mounting holes through the desired mounting surface to allow fitment of each mounting bracket.
Please note there are left and right hand side mounting brackets, see previous page for correct positioning or
use the mounting brackets as templates.
Tighten the mounting screws to secure the mounting bracket (Maximum torque 1.5Nm).
Push the outer end of the lamp module into the hole at one end of the mounting bracket.
Adjust the angle of the lamp module inside the mounting bracket so that its centre line is parallel with the ground.
Push the inner end of the lamp module into the slot of the mounting bracket until it clicks into place.
Wiring Instructions
It is a legal requirement for daytime running lamps to illuminate only when the ignition is switched ON and the
vehicle lighting is switched OFF.
To meet this requirement it is recommended that a 5 pin change-over relay is utlilised as per the wiring diagram
below. For blister packed Safety DayLight™ DRL kits also refer to the mounting instructions included with the
Safety Daylights™ Smart Controller.

Note 1: Lamps and relay must be protected by a fuse rated at 5 amperes maximum.
Note 2: Lamp is polarity conscious. The reversal of the polarity will not damage this product but will inhibit its function.
Note 3: Daytime running lamps are not a substitute for dipped beam headlights at dusk/dawn or during darkness.
